技术领域Technical field
本发明涉及医疗内科技术领域,具体为一种用于呼吸道的吸痰装置。The invention relates to the technical field of medical internal medicine, specifically a sputum suction device for the respiratory tract.
背景技术Background technique
患有呼吸道疾病的患者其呼吸道内常常淤积有大量的痰,如果不能及时将其清除的话就会影响到患者的正常呼吸,严重者还会引发窒息从而造成生命危险。现有的除痰大多都是由医护人员将管子插入患者的呼吸道,然后通过管子将痰液吸出来,这种方法费时费力,当患者意识不清晰无法自主张嘴时还需要医护人员将患者的嘴撑开,因此需要消耗额外的人力资源,并且在吸痰时医护人员的手容易抖动,从而难以控制吸痰的力度和角度,容易弄伤患者的呼吸道。Patients with respiratory diseases often have a large amount of phlegm accumulated in the respiratory tract. If it cannot be removed in time, it will affect the patient's normal breathing. In severe cases, it may cause suffocation and endanger life. Most of the existing phlegm removal methods require medical staff to insert a tube into the patient's respiratory tract, and then suck out the sputum through the tube. This method is time-consuming and laborious. When the patient is unconscious and unable to open his or her own mouth, the medical staff also needs to remove the patient's mouth. Therefore, additional human resources are required to expand, and the hands of medical staff tend to shake when suctioning sputum, making it difficult to control the strength and angle of sputum suction, and easily injuring the patient's respiratory tract.

用于呼吸道的吸痰装置工作原理:Working principle of sputum suction device for respiratory tract:
用于呼吸道的吸痰装置使用时,通过握柄15握住该吸痰装置,从而稳定该装置防止晃动,然后将吸痰管8伸入至患者的呼吸道内,利用弹簧12的弹性作用可通过撑块11将患者的嘴部撑开,从而方便医护人员机进行吸痰,撑块11上设置有若干个消毒棉球27,当与患者口腔内壁接触时可起到消毒作用,防止细菌感染,吸痰时,通过握住把手28带动传动块22向外拉动,从而通过传动块22带动推拉块20连同活塞杆19向外拉动,活塞杆19向外拉动时可带动活塞18沿着活塞腔3向外移动,通过活塞18的向外移动可使得吸痰腔2内的气压变小,当吸痰管8伸入患者呼吸道时通过其末端的吸痰海绵25可吸收淤积在患者呼吸道中的痰液,并利用活塞18运动所产生的负压将痰液透过吸痰孔24吸入至吸痰管8中,随着活塞18的不断往复运动可将痰液吸入至吸痰腔2,并通过导流块13导入至集痰瓶14中,从而将痰液清除并回收。When using the sputum suction device for the respiratory tract, hold the sputum suction device by the handle 15 to stabilize the device to prevent shaking, then extend the sputum suction tube 8 into the patient's respiratory tract, and use the elastic effect of the spring 12 to pass through The support block 11 opens the patient's mouth, thereby making it convenient for the medical staff to suction sputum. Several sterile cotton balls 27 are provided on the support block 11. When in contact with the inner wall of the patient's oral cavity, they can disinfect and prevent bacterial infection. When suctioning sputum, hold the handle 28 to drive the transmission block 22 to pull outward, thereby driving the push-pull block 20 together with the piston rod 19 to pull outward through the transmission block 22. When the piston rod 19 is pulled outward, the piston 18 can be driven along the piston cavity 3 By moving outward, the outward movement of the piston 18 can make the air pressure in the sputum suction chamber 2 smaller. When the sputum suction tube 8 extends into the patient's respiratory tract, the sputum suction sponge 25 at its end can absorb the phlegm accumulated in the patient's respiratory tract. liquid, and use the negative pressure generated by the movement of the piston 18 to suck the sputum into the sputum suction tube 8 through the sputum suction hole 24. With the continuous reciprocating movement of the piston 18, the sputum can be sucked into the sputum suction chamber 2, and pass through The guide block 13 is introduced into the sputum collecting bottle 14 to remove and recover sputum.
